Exegesis
The verse begins with the sequential marker wayyomer {וַיֹּ֤אמֶר | wayyōmer} ‘and he said’, where the vav-consecutive signals narrative progression.
In context — Judges 19:12
And his master said to him, “We will not turn aside into a foreign city , which is not of the sons of Israel; instead, we will proceed on to Gibeah.”
